Summary:Using a flow microreactor system, carbamoyllithium compounds were successfully generated and used for reactions with electrophiles to give various amides, including α‐ketoamides. The present method could be applied to the three‐component synthesis of functionalized α‐ketoamides using a carbamoyllithium compound, methyl chloroformate, and a functionalized organolithium reagent.
